Transaction fa6d24905c4103d26032ba0936f4470c74bf9a36e3c576ab56a5ebb6f9bddb71
1 Input
1 Output
-
fa6d24905c4103d26032ba0936f4470c74bf9a36e3c576ab56a5ebb6f9bddb71:0
- value
- 638960
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1baef27cb55cdd534fe64393dc1876799da4e3e OP_EQUAL
- address
- 3HtmTux21tAur2GWMYf65Cev9qR3JBy4BZ